Founded in 1915, the Rotary Club of Knoxville is the city’s oldest and largest service club. The club is apolitical and secular, welcoming members from all communities.
We meet every Tuesday at noon. Our weekly lunches give our members valuable insight into our community and the world while networking with community leaders.

Meeting Recap: 2023 Scholarship Winners
The program for the day was the Rotary Foundation of Knoxville Scholarship Awards Committee presentation of college scholarships to two area high school graduates. RFK Member Ray Mowery presented the program on behalf of the Committee. Ray noted the hard work and excellent leadership of Committee Chair Jennifer Sepaniak. He noted that all of the Committee members seemed to enjoy serving on the Committee and the process of meeting and selecting scholarship award recipients, and encouraged all Rotary Club of Knoxville members to try to serve on the Committee at some point.

Rotary Foundation of Knoxville

The Rotary Foundation of Knoxville provides funding for two primary missions of the Rotary Club of Knoxville: college scholarships and special projects.
